Understanding Your NBA Streaming Options in Canada
So, you're looking to stream some NBA games, eh? Awesome! But before we jump into the nitty-gritty, it's important to understand the landscape. When it comes to watching NBA games online in Canada, you've got a few main avenues to explore. Each option offers different features, pricing, and game availability, so choosing the right one depends on your viewing habits and preferences. The main options include NBA League Pass, sports streaming services like DAZN and TSN Direct, and traditional cable subscriptions with online access. NBA League Pass is the official streaming service of the NBA, offering access to almost every game live and on-demand. However, it's important to check for blackout restrictions, which may prevent you from watching certain local games. Sports streaming services like DAZN and TSN Direct offer a broader range of sports content, including NBA games, along with other leagues and events. These services often come with more affordable pricing compared to traditional cable subscriptions, making them attractive options for cord-cutters. Traditional cable subscriptions, while often more expensive, provide access to NBA games through channels like TSN and Sportsnet, along with the added benefit of watching other TV shows and movies. Many cable providers also offer online streaming options, allowing you to watch games on your computer, tablet, or smartphone.

Top Streaming Services for NBA Games in Canada
Alright, let's break down the best streaming services for catching NBA games here in Canada. We'll cover the key features, pricing, and what makes each one stand out, so you can make an informed decision and not miss a single buzzer-beater. NBA League Pass is a classic for a reason. It gives you access to almost every single NBA game live and on-demand. Think of it as the ultimate NBA buffet! However, and this is a big however, blackout restrictions can apply, meaning you might not be able to watch local games. So, check the fine print before you sign up. DAZN is another solid option. It's not just NBA, but also a bunch of other sports. It's like a sports smorgasbord! The pricing is usually pretty reasonable, making it a good choice if you're into more than just basketball. TSN Direct is also in the mix. If you're a fan of Canadian sports coverage, TSN is likely already on your radar. With TSN Direct, you can stream all the NBA games they broadcast, along with their other sports content. Sportsnet NOW is another contender, similar to TSN Direct. It offers streaming access to the NBA games broadcast on Sportsnet, as well as a variety of other sports. If you're already a Sportsnet subscriber, this is a no-brainer.
Cable subscriptions with online access: Don't forget the old-school route! If you have a cable subscription that includes TSN and Sportsnet, you can usually stream their content online through their respective apps or websites. Tips for a Smooth NBA Streaming Experience
Nobody wants lag during a crucial game-winning shot, right? Here are some tips to ensure your NBA streaming experience is as smooth as butter. First, check your internet speed. This is huge. NBA streams are data-heavy, and a slow connection will lead to buffering nightmares. Aim for at least 25 Mbps for a reliable HD stream. You can test your speed with a free online tool like Speedtest.net. If your speed is lacking, consider upgrading your internet plan or contacting your provider for assistance. Second, optimize your Wi-Fi. A strong Wi-Fi signal is just as important as your internet speed. Make sure your router is in a central location and away from obstructions like walls and metal objects. If you're streaming on a device that's far from your router, consider using a Wi-Fi extender or a wired Ethernet connection. Third, close unnecessary apps and programs. When you're streaming, close any other apps or programs that are using your internet connection. This will free up bandwidth and improve your streaming performance. Fourth, update your devices and apps. Make sure your streaming devices, apps, and web browsers are up to date. Updates often include performance improvements and bug fixes that can improve your streaming experience.
Consider using a streaming device. Smart TVs are great, but dedicated streaming devices like Roku, Apple TV, and Chromecast often offer better performance and more features. They also tend to receive updates more frequently. Adjust the streaming quality. If you're still experiencing buffering issues, try lowering the streaming quality in your streaming service's settings. This will reduce the amount of data being streamed and may improve performance. Watch out for blackout restrictions. As we mentioned earlier, blackout restrictions can prevent you from watching certain local games on NBA League Pass. Check the blackout schedule before you start streaming to avoid disappointment. Use a VPN (Virtual Private Network). In some cases, a VPN can help you bypass blackout restrictions or improve your streaming speed. However, keep in mind that using a VPN may violate the terms of service of your streaming provider. Monitor your data usage. NBA streams can consume a lot of data, especially if you're streaming in HD. If you have a limited data plan, be sure to monitor your usage to avoid overage charges. You can usually find data usage information in your streaming service's settings or on your device.
